【api接口是什么意思】API(Application Programming Interface,应用程序编程接口)是软件之间进行通信和数据交换的桥梁。它定义了不同系统或程序如何相互调用、传递数据和执行操作。通过API,开发者可以无需了解底层实现细节,即可使用其他系统的功能。
在实际应用中,API广泛用于网站、移动应用、云服务、第三方平台等场景,使不同系统能够高效协作。常见的API类型包括REST API、SOAP API、GraphQL API等,每种都有其适用场景和特点。
以下是对API接口的简要总结,并以表格形式展示关键信息:
| 项目 | 内容 |
| 全称 | Application Programming Interface(应用程序编程接口) |
| 定义 | 一组预定义的函数或协议,用于不同软件系统之间的交互与数据交换。 |
| 作用 | 实现系统间的数据共享、功能调用、服务集成,提升开发效率。 |
| 常见类型 | REST API、SOAP API、GraphQL API、RPC API 等 |
| 应用场景 | 网站后端与前端交互、移动应用与服务器通信、第三方服务接入、微服务架构等 |
| 优点 | 提高开发效率、降低耦合度、便于维护和扩展 |
| 缺点 | 需要文档支持、安全性需保障、版本更新可能影响兼容性 |
| 示例 | 调用天气API获取实时天气信息、调用支付API完成交易等 |
总结:
API接口是一种让不同系统或程序之间“说话”的方式。它简化了开发流程,使得开发者可以专注于自己的业务逻辑,而不必从头构建所有功能。理解API的核心概念,有助于更好地使用和开发现代应用程序。


